1 Egg
2 Egg whites
¼ teaspoon Salt
1/8 teaspoon Pepper
2 tablespoons Freshly squeezed lemon juice
½ cup Margarine
2 tablespoons Boiling water
1/3 cup Coarsely chopped, roasted American pistachios
Combine, egg, egg whites, salt, pepper, and lemon juice in electric blender. Blend for 30 seconds until thoroughly “fluffed”. Melt margarine in saucepan or microwave oven until melted and foaming hot. While whirring blender, remove center “pour hole” part of lid and slowly pour margarine into egg mixture, incorporating it well. In similar manner, slowly pour in boiling water. Stir, don’t whir, in pistachios. If you prefer a slightly thicker sauce, turn it into top of double boiler, and cook over simmering water, stirring with wire whip, until thickness is desired.
